Add another boutique to Brooklyn’s must-visit list. Candice Waldron’s Jumelle (148 Bedford Ave., nr. N. 9th St., Williamsburg, Brooklyn; 718-388-9525) follows fashion (you’ll see delicate spring neutrals), but not slavishly, with a well-edited mix of labels like Sonia by Sonia Rykiel, Cacharel, and Alexandre Herchcovitch.
Frédéric Fekkai has moved from 57th Street to the fourth floor of Henri Bendel (712 Fifth Ave., at 56th St.; 212-753-9500). New touches include a men’s styling lounge.
